Brooklyn Nets vs Toronto Raptors Analysis
The Toronto Raptors hit the road and travel south to the Barclays Center to face the Brooklyn Nets in a battle of Atlantic Division rivals. The Nets were boatraced 130-102 on Wednesday night against the New Orleans Pelicans.
While the Raptors came out on top 108-105 at home over the new look Cleveland Cavaliers. This will be the first of four games between these squads after splitting the season series a year ago. Tip-off is scheduled for 7:30 PM EST/4:30 PST.
